Output 95800421be41b17aafacbfe338e26e44839b7feaec96c5df9b2ee8541ba2cf6a:0

value
3027817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f987ce34ad42405e4ca6da16652f4d4e58903655 OP_EQUAL
address
3QSQsEuFJXD69pXZjZAXh9h33QbVLmXP55
transaction
95800421be41b17aafacbfe338e26e44839b7feaec96c5df9b2ee8541ba2cf6a
spent
true